Sundarbans


Sunderbans
Location:  Bali
Year: 2010

Overview:

Sunderbans a world Heritage sight as declared by UNESCO houses the worlds largest delta and the planets largest mangrove forest, exotic flora & fauna and protects the world from the adverse affects of climate change by acting as a carbon sink. The population is in dire economic crisis with almost no basic amenities leave alone education for children.

Aim Of the Project:

To make available a creative outlet for under privileged children and to channelize their energy and creative instincts.

Our team had conducted field research, conceptualized and developed a communication initiatives and processed techniques to optimize the available resources best suited to benefit the community in one of the most under privileged areas. The overall approach to the issue was to harmonize the emotional quotient of the beneficiaries, children. The entire process was targeted at getting the best out of them so as to enable us to get the best for them in short or long run. 

The Project

SELF FUNDED
No of children: 37
Age group: 5 – 12 years

Theme of the three day workshop was to distribute materials like drawing sheets, pencils and colors to initiate a sketching, drawing and painting session amongst children in the village.
The topics that were given were simple: to draw or paint anything that attracted them in their surroundings or anything that they loved to see in their village.

The imagination was as diverse as : tigers , boats , the rivers , a tree and Bonbibi ( the forest Goddess ) . The second step was interactions on why they had chosen a particular thing to draw and an elaboration on the same. The interactive session was extremely helpful as each came up with not only a story on their likes & dislikes but also communicated with others and even tried to influence their individual choices.

The workshop thus was not only successful in channelizing their creative instincts but also a platform for the children who had logical explanations and analytical skills to establish their likes & dislikes.

The workshop was wrapped up with a round of games amongst all , with prizes for the winners.
